God’s Extended Hand of Mercy


Blessed is the man that trusteth in the LORD, and whose hope the LORD is. For he shall be as a tree planted by the waters, and that spreadeth out her roots by the river, and shall not see when heat cometh, but her leaf shall be green; and shall not be careful in the year of drought, neither shall cease from yielding fruit. Jeremiah 17:7-8


Because of the sin of Judah which included idolatry and desecration of the Sabbath day, God promised destruction and curses upon the people. These people were very wicked and vile and deserved the consequences of their sin. But at the same time God extends his hand of mercy and grace to those who would trust in Him rather than their human leaders and idols. He gives them a second chance. Later in this chapter Jeremiah preaches of God’s mercy to those who would hallow the Sabbath day. Most reject God’s extended hand which offers mercy and blessing to the nation of Judah.


Jeremiah contrasts the consequences of trusting in human strength versus relying on God. The blessing is upon those who place their faith and confidence in God. The “tree planted by the water” suggests continual nourishment, resilience, and fruitfulness. As we face temptations and adversity those who trust in God remain strong, secure, and productive.


Trust in the LORD with all thine heart; and lean not unto thine own understanding. In all thy ways acknowledge him, and he shall direct thy paths. Proverbs 3:5-6


We are to examine where we place our trust. God extends His hand of mercy to each of us, if we will look to Him in faith.
